Call log — Dial from the call log. See the Call Log section for details on page 16.
Directory — Dial from the Phone Directory. See the Phone Directory section for
details on page 17.
One-touch speed dial — Press the desired "One Touch" speed dial key to call a
pre-programmed number.
Outside line access code is dialed automatically before any number with 7 or
more digits stored in the call log, directory, or memory buttons.
If you use the telephone keypad to dial a number, please dial the outside line
access code before the number.
You can switch a call between the handset, speakerphone or headset during the
call by either lifting the handset, pressing the speaker or headset buttons.
